Purpose-built rig set on fire for wall cladding tests

From Morning Report, 7:43 am on 19 February 2020

Fire tests of cladding on multistorey buildings are being run in New Zealand for the first time in response to the Grenfell Tower disaster in London three years ago.

A purpose-built rig near Porirua will be used to set alight wall assemblies to see how they burn.
